### Step 4: Locale settings for date formats

Almost there! DateSmith handles all the locale-aware date rendering for the Pennywhistle dashboard, so users in different regions see formats they actually recognize. In the deploy `.env`, set `DATESMITH_DEFAULT_LOCALE` (we use `en-CA` on staging) and `DATESMITH_FALLBACK_TZ` for users with no profile timezone. DateSmith also pulls locale bundles from the Lingora bundle service, which needs authentication or you'll get bare ISO strings everywhere. Put the Lingora credential on the very next line.

sealed setting: ARCHIVE_KEY3=8d0

## Environments

Quick note for the security review: Ledgerline's payroll export moved from the old fixed-width format to signed JSON bundles last sprint. Staging and prod now diverge only in signing-key rotation cadence, and the sandbox still emits the legacy format for one more cycle. Each environment picks up its behaviour from the values below.

deployment values, faduf-tawep:
SORDOR_LOG_LEVEL=error
SORDOR_METRICS_HOST=metrics.sordor.nelvrolabs.internal
SORDOR_POOL_SIZE=4

**CI note: timezone weirdness in report exports**

Heads up, support folks — if a customer says their Ledgerpine export shows times shifted by a few hours, it's probably the CI image. The export workers got rebuilt last week and the base image defaults to UTC, while older workers used the account's locale. Fix is rolling out; meanwhile tell customers the data itself is fine, just the display offset. Affected exports carry the build token shown below.

build token for bajof-tahop: htk4_a981

Incremental Rebuilds: Stale Pages After Content Push

When the Staticore rebuild pipeline serves outdated pages, first verify the change-detection manifest updated after the content push; a stale manifest means the differ never ran. Next, inspect the rebuild queue depth — anything above 500 entries indicates the worker pool is saturated and pages will lag. If both look healthy, trigger a targeted rebuild for the affected paths via the admin API, authenticating with the bearer token below.

session JWT of yawep-yawep = eyJhbGciOiJIUzI1NiIsInR5cCI6IkpXVCJ9.eyJzdWIiOiI3pWF3_In0.aXYsHiog